Backyard party essentials

Everything you need for your next outdoor bash

By Jen O'Brien
Backyard party essentials

Jericho beverage dispenser

Get it at Urban Barn

Forget running to the fridge for refreshments - this nine-litre punch bowl alternative will all you to keep your bevvies (alcoholic or otherwise) perfectly chilled and easily pourable.
